TrustLab
trustlab.comLocations
Palo Alto, CA, USA · San Francisco, CA, USA
industry
Internet Services
Size
51 - 200 employees
Stage
Other
founded in
2019
TrustLab is an AI software company used to protect against misinformation, hate speech, identity fraud, and other harmful content.
Something looks off?Open jobs at TrustLab
On-site & Remote
Job function
Seniority
Salary